The Magic Treehouse is the debut album from Ooberman, released in October 1999 on Independiente Records. The album was produced by Stephen Street, famous for his work with The Smiths and Blur, among others. Four singles were released from the album - "Blossoms Falling", "Million Suns", "Tears From A Willow" and "Shorley Wall". An earlier version of "Shorley Wall" had previous been the lead track of an EP released by the band on Tugboat Records. A demo recording of Sugar Bum was released as a single on Graham Coxon's Transcopic label in May 1998. This was the band's first official release.
